Many businesses that are already leveraging SEO or those wondering whether investing in SEO is worth it often ask the question: What is the ROI of SEO?
Usually, the answer you get is “it depends,” but with the SEO ROI Calculator, you can find a clear and accurate answer.
Whether you are just getting started or already working with an SEO company that is bringing you traffic, our SEO ROI Calculator helps you see exactly what you are gaining from your SEO efforts.
For example, let’s say you are a small business leveraging SEO and generating 10,000 visits. You might be getting enough leads, or perhaps your traffic is not converting well.
Using the SEO ROI Calculator, you can easily measure how your traffic translates into leads, sales, and real revenue.
Now, calculate your SEO ROI with confidence by measuring it against your leads and sales.
SEO ROI Calculator
Looking for a better ROI
Let an expert SEO bring the results you deserve.
How This SEO ROI Calculator Works
Many businesses invest in SEO without knowing exactly how much return they are getting. This calculator helps you measure your SEO ROI accurately based on traffic, conversions, lead value, and sales value.
Traffic details:
It starts by asking how much traffic you are currently getting and how much traffic you want to reach within a specific period.

For instance, if you are getting 10,000 visitors a month. If your SEO company is expected to get you 30,000 visitors in the next 6 months, that would be the goal value.
You will also provide how much time it will take to reach that goal.
You will then provide your monthly SEO cost.
Industry details:
Next, you select your industry to understand the average conversion rates, both from traffic to leads and from leads to sales.
We’ve made your ROI calculations easier with the SEO ROI Calculator, by adding industry conversion averages for various SMBs and corporations.
Now, you don’t have to figure out the average conversion rates yourself.
For example, whether you’re a tech company, in real estate, healthcare, an eCommerce store, a local business, a BPO company, or any other B2B business, we’ve included industry-specific conversion data from research that can help you make better estimations with our SEO ROI Calculator.
However, for larger enterprises, the situation can be more complex, and the ROI estimation might differ based on their team and efforts.
That’s why we give you the flexibility to enter your own conversion rates and data. The SEO ROI Calculator allows full customization, so you’re not limited to industry averages.
If you already know your specific conversion rates, you can enter your own.
Leads and Sales value:
Finally, you enter the value you associate with each lead and each sale.
Using all this information, the calculator gives you two important ROI results:
SEO ROI based on leads:
This shows how much it costs you to acquire a qualified lead. Why is this important? Because sometimes, converting leads into sales is difficult due to internal issues. For example, you may have a bad reputation, your team lead might be difficult to work with, or your team may not respond to leads quickly. In such cases, your conversion rate from leads to sales is low, and you should focus on improving your sales process.
SEO ROI based on sales:
This shows how much revenue you are making and what your ROI percentage is.
For example, if you are an e-commerce company generating 20,000 monthly visits, you can find out exactly how much revenue you are driving, not just how much traffic you are getting.
What is a good ROI for SEO?
A good ROI for SEO typically ranges between 100% and 300%. This means for every dollar spent on SEO, you should ideally generate an additional $1 to $3 in revenue. However, the ROI depends on industry, competition, and your business goals.
What is the average ROI of SEO?
The average ROI of SEO varies widely, but on average, businesses see about $2 for every $1 spent on SEO. Depending on factors like industry and strategy, this number can go much higher with effective optimization.
How do you calculate ROI on SEO?
To calculate ROI on SEO, you measure the revenue generated from SEO-driven leads and sales. Subtract your total SEO costs from the generated revenue, then divide by the SEO costs. Multiply the result by 100 to get the ROI percentage. This gives you a clear view of the profitability of your SEO investment.
What does ROI stand for in SEO?
ROI stands for Return on Investment. In SEO, it represents the ratio of revenue generated from organic traffic to the cost spent on SEO efforts. It shows the profit earned compared to what you invested.
How is Enterprise SEO ROI calculated?
Enterprise SEO ROI is calculated by measuring the revenue generated from SEO-driven traffic, leads, and sales across multiple domains, regions, or business units. You subtract the total SEO investment (including tools, teams, and agency fees) from the revenue earned, divide the result by the total SEO cost, and multiply by 100. This gives the ROI percentage, showing the profitability of your enterprise SEO efforts.